Manufacturer :
onsemi
Product Category :
Instrumentation, OP Amps, Buffer Amps
Mounting Type :
Surface Mount
Voltage - Input Offset :
2mV
Package / Case :
14-SOIC (0.154, 3.90mm Width)
Moisture Sensitivity Level (MSL) :
1 (Unlimited)
Current - Input Bias :
90nA
Voltage - Supply, Single/Dual (±) :
3V~32V
Pbfree Code :
yes
Factory Lead Time :
5 Weeks
Operating Temperature :
0°C~70°C
Current - Output / Channel :
40mA
Number of Circuits :
4
Amplifier Type :
GENERAL PURPOSE
Packaging :
Tape and Reel (TR)
RoHS Status :
ROHS3 Compliant
Lifecycle Status :
ACTIVE (Last Updated: 1 week ago)
Published :
2015
Current - Supply :
3mA
